WebJul 17, 2012 · Well, the master cylinder is tasked with supplying hydraulic pressure to the braking system. So when you initially step on the brake pedal the linkage activates a piston within the system and this piston then displaces hydraulic fluid. Once a certain pressure is reached a secondary piston is then activated if you have a dual circuit system. WebFeb 19, 2024 · As a warning to the driver that there is a fault in either the primary or secondary hydraulic braking circuits of a dual-line braking system, a pressure differential warning actuator is usually incorporated as an integral part of the master cylinder or it may be installed as a separate unit (Fig. 11.27).

For vehicles equipped with a combination valve, hwy 5 south closureWebJun 23, 2024 · The Brake Master Cylinder is the heart of the braking system. It converts the force placed on the pedal into hydraulic pressure. Then, the pressure forces fluid through the brake lines and hoses. For power-assisted brakes, the master cylinder is attached to the Brake Booster.
